A curative treatment strategy using tumor debulking surgery combined with immune checkpoint inhibitors for advanced pediatric solid tumors: An in vivo study using a murine model of osteosarcoma
Topic overview
Murine osteosarcoma model demonstrates that combining tumor debulking surgery with triple immune checkpoint inhibitor therapy (anti-Tim-3, anti-PD-L1, anti-OX-86) significantly improves survival and prevents lung metastasis compared to either treatment alone. This combination approach shows promise as a curative strategy for advanced pediatric solid tumors.
